Output 31a1a3b284d3eec365358d03d106af6040419d3aa45c6ef440af8f5c04768fff:43

value
88000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bf27edf479f9765b2abd3c7be25975f0ce92c6a OP_EQUAL
address
3FubAAdDPX55JrAirTFWABQjXX4U8toEUE
transaction
31a1a3b284d3eec365358d03d106af6040419d3aa45c6ef440af8f5c04768fff
spent
true